Girl Scouts Collecting Coats For Domestic Violence Victims

The need has never been greater and it’s never been easier to make a difference in your community. Here is your opportunity to make sure that nobody goes without such a basic necessity as a coat this winter.

Oxford Girl Scouts are collecting clean, gently used coats and jackets as part of a community service project. Coats of all shapes and sizes are welcome; especially in need are coats for young children. We are also accepting hat, mittens, gloves and scarves.

The Oxford Girl Scouts have made donating a coat simple. Just bring your clean, gently used coats and jackets to Oxford Town Hall from 9am to 1pm on December 15, 2012. If you can’t make it to town hall, you can drop off you donation to any of the following locations from Dec. to Dec. 14: 

  • Quaker Farms School
  • Oxford Center School
  • Ridge Club at the Oxford Greens
  • Oxford Senior Center
  • Allstate Insurance — 1510 Southford Rd Southbury, CT
  • Danz Magic — 198 Seymour Avenue Derby, CT 06418

Then the Girl Scouts will take care of the rest. All donated coats will be given to My Sister’s Place – serving women and children of domestic violence.
